Tunisia''s national grid is connected to those of Algeria and Libya which together helped supply about 12% of Tunisia''s power consumption in the first half of 2023.

A significant number of 5G base stations (gNBs) and their backup energy storage systems (BESSs) are redundantly configured, possessing surplus capacity during non-peak traffic hours.
